Air handling unit (AHU) heaters are integral components in HVAC systems, designed to heat the air before it is distributed throughout a building. These heaters are typically placed within the air handling unit to warm the air as it passes through. The heat can be generated using electric, gas, or hot water heating methods, depending on the system’s design. Electric heaters use resistance coils, while gas-fired units rely on combustion to generate heat
